Equity-Minded and Culturally-Affirming Teaching and Learning Practices in Virtual Learning Communities - NIU - Keep Teaching
Equity-Minded and Culturally-Affirming Teaching and Learning Practices in Virtual Learning Communities - NIU - Keep Teaching
In this webinar on Thursday, March 26, 2020 hosted by the Center for Organizational Responsibility and Advancement (CORA) through San Diego State University, Drs. Frank Harris III and J. Luke Wood present some salient trends and issues that complicate the experiences of diverse learners in online courses and propose equity-minded teaching and learning strategies for faculty teaching online courses. This webinar is free and open to the public.
